Siegecraft Commander

Siegecraft Commander
Blowfish Studios
sku: 62ebe2960eb8bd007dc08e3f
$11.30-71%
$3.29
Shipping from: United Kingdom
   Price history chart & currency exchange rate

Customers also viewed